The Evolution of Mobile Cameras: How Smartphones Became Photography Powerhouses
Mobile cameras have transformed the way we capture and share moments. From low-quality VGA sensors in early phones to today’s multi-lens systems with advanced processing, smartphone cameras have become powerful tools that rival professional photography equipment. Whether you're capturing everyday moments or creating high-quality content, mobile camera technology has evolved dramatically, offering stunning image quality in a compact device.
The Evolution of Mobile Camera
1. From Basic Snappers to High-Resolution Lenses
The first mobile cameras were simple and low-resolution, capable of taking grainy, pixelated images. Early devices like the Nokia 7650 (2002) and Sony Ericsson T610 (2003) introduced mobile photography, but their capabilities were extremely limited.
Fast forward to today, and smartphones now feature 108MP sensors, periscope zoom, and advanced image processing, producing photos that compete with professional cameras. Devices like the Samsung Galaxy S23 Ultra and iPhone 15 Pro Max allow users to take sharp, detailed images with features once found only in high-end cameras.
2. The Rise of Multi-Camera Setups
Modern smartphones use multiple lenses to enhance versatility and improve photography in different conditions:
- Wide-Angle Lens – The standard lens for everyday photography.
- Ultra-Wide Lens – Captures a broader scene, perfect for landscapes and group shots.
- Telephoto Lens – Enables optical zoom without losing image quality.
- Macro Lens – Ideal for extreme close-ups and capturing fine details.
- Periscope Lens – Provides enhanced zoom capabilities while maintaining a slim design.
With these lens combinations, smartphones can now handle everything from portrait photography to night shots and professional videography.
Key Technologies Powering Mobile Cameras
1. Computational Photography
Smartphones now use advanced image processing to enhance photos automatically. Features like Night Mode, Portrait Mode, and HDR improve lighting, color balance, and overall detail, making every shot look professional with minimal effort.
2. Optical Image Stabilization (OIS) & Sensor-Shift Technology
To prevent blurriness caused by shaky hands, many high-end smartphones include OIS or sensor-shift stabilization, ensuring sharp images even in low-light conditions or while recording videos on the move.
3. Scene Recognition & Auto-Enhancements
Modern smartphones can recognize different scenes, subjects, and lighting conditions, adjusting settings in real time for the best possible image. Whether taking a portrait, a landscape, or a close-up, the camera optimizes settings to deliver the best shot without requiring manual adjustments.
Smartphone Cameras vs. Professional Cameras
While smartphones have significantly improved, DSLR and mirrorless cameras still offer advantages in sensor size, manual controls, and lens options. However, the portability, convenience, and advanced image processing of smartphones make them the preferred choice for casual and even semi-professional photographers.
